What's The Definition Of Synodal?Synonyms | Synonyms for Synodal: Related Terms | Find terms related to Synodal: See Also | Synodal In Webster's Dictionary \Syn"od*al\, a. [L. synodalis: cf. F. synodal.]
Synodical. --Milton.
\Syn"od*al\, n. 1. (Ch. of Eng.) A tribute in money formerly paid to the bishop or archdeacon, at the time of his Easter visitation, by every parish priest, now made to the ecclesiastical commissioners; a procuration. Synodals are due, of common right, to the bishop only. --Gibson. 2. A constitution made in a provincial or diocesan synod. |
